Abstract :
Existing business process support systems focus on execution of highly structured business processes which are represented in a formal modeling notation. These systems fail, if processes are weakly structured or if process changes have to be considered during execution. Therefore, an information logistics architecture is proposed to support business processes, especially those which rely on informational inputs and produce information as an output. The architecture is based on software agent technology to flexibly monitor distributed activities. A showcase of the architecture to support a sales planning process is implemented in cooperation with an industry partner
